Royal United Hospitals Bath NHS Foundation Trust

Medical Secretary - Older People

The closing date is 15 July 2025

Job summary

We are looking for an organized and agile Medical Secretary to cover up to a year's maternity leave within our older people's team. We are a small, but supportive team, working with the multi-disciplinary teams across OPU and Stroke. We will support your learning and development within this role, to build your skills to keep these services running smoothly.

Main duties of the job

To provide complete medical secretarial service to include word processing and audio-typing, producing clinical letters and other documents

Organization of meetings and minute-taking

Liaise with MDT to help organize clinics and bookings

Take and relay telephone inquiries in a polite and helpful manner, prioritizing issues and taking action as appropriate

Disclosure and Barring Service Check

This post is subject to the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act (Exceptions Order) 1975 and as such it will be necessary for a submission for Disclosure to be made to the Disclosure and Barring Service (formerly known as CRB) to check for any previous criminal convictions.
